How Do Aluminum Crossbow Bolts Compare to Other Bolt Materials?

Aluminum crossbow bolts offer various advantages and disadvantages compared to other materials such as carbon and fiberglass. Here is a comparison of their key characteristics:

MaterialWeightDurabilityCostPerformanceFlexibilityNoise Level
AluminumModerateGoodModerateStable flight, good penetrationLowModerate
CarbonLightweightHighHigherExcellent speed, less dragModerateLow
FiberglassHeavierModerateLowGood for beginners, less accurateHighHigh

Each material has its unique benefits: Aluminum bolts are known for their consistent performance and durability, while carbon bolts are preferred for their lightweight and speed. Fiberglass bolts are often chosen for their cost-effectiveness, especially for novice users.

What Key Features Should You Look for in Aluminum Crossbow Bolts?

The key features to look for in aluminum crossbow bolts include weight, spine stiffness, fletching type, and construction quality.

  1. Weight:
  2. Spine Stiffness:
  3. Fletching Type:
  4. Construction Quality:

Considering these features can greatly influence performance, accuracy, and bolt lifespan in different conditions and applications.

  1. Weight:
    Weight is a crucial feature of aluminum crossbow bolts. It affects both speed and trajectory. Heavier bolts offer more kinetic energy but experience more drop over distances. Lighter bolts fly faster and flatter, making them ideal for short-range shots. Manufacturers often specify recommended weights for optimal performance with specific crossbow models; this can be critical to consider when selecting bolts.

  2. Spine Stiffness:
    Spine stiffness refers to a bolt’s rigidity when force is applied. It is vital for accuracy and flight stability. A spine that is too weak can lead to poor arrow flight and accuracy. Conversely, a spine that is too stiff can result in poor performance. Different crossbows require different spine ratings. The correct spine stiffness will match the draw weight of the crossbow being used, which ensures a consistent and stable flight path.

  3. Fletching Type:
    Fletching influences the bolt’s stability during flight. Common types include vanes and feathers. Vanes are often preferred for crossbows due to their durability and weather resistance. The number and arrangement of fletchings can also affect accuracy. For instance, three fletchings provide better stabilization compared to two. A well-chosen fletching type can enhance overall performance in varying conditions.

  4. Construction Quality:
    Construction quality ensures the durability and reliability of aluminum crossbow bolts. Higher-quality materials lead to longer-lasting bolts that can withstand repeated use and the stresses from high-speed shots. Some bolts are anodized for corrosion resistance, prolonging their lifespan. Ensuring the bolts are manufactured to stringent quality standards also minimizes the risk of bending or breaking during use, which can be a safety concern.

Considering these features collectively will help in selecting the best aluminum crossbow bolts suited for your shooting style and needs.

How Can You Properly Maintain Aluminum Crossbow Bolts to Ensure Longevity?

To properly maintain aluminum crossbow bolts and ensure their longevity, follow these key practices: regular cleaning, proper storage, inspection for damage, and periodic tuning of the crossbow.

Regular cleaning is essential to remove dirt and debris. Clean the bolts after each use. Use a soft cloth and mild soap solution to wipe off any residue. Av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the finish. A study by Archery Research Institute (2022) shows that consistent cleaning extends the life of archery equipment.

Proper storage helps prevent bending and damage. Store aluminum bolts in a designated quiver or padded case. Keep them away from extreme temperatures and direct sunlight. This prevents warping and fading, ensuring the bolts maintain their structural integrity.

Inspection for damage is crucial. Before each use, visually check the bolts for dents, bends, or cracks. If any bolts show signs of significant wear or damage, they should be replaced immediately. According to the National Archery Association (2021), damaged bolts can lead to inaccurate shooting and safety hazards.

Periodic tuning of the crossbow affects bolt performance. Check the bowstring and cam timing regularly. Ensure the bolts fit properly in the rail and observe how they perform when shot. Adjustments may be needed to achieve optimal accuracy and efficiency. Regular tuning is recommended by the American Crossbow Society (2023) for improved performance.

Following these practices will help maintain the performance and lifespan of aluminum crossbow bolts.
